Question #2:
Do your payment gateways ensure secure and smooth transactions?
For developers creating your e-commerce, ensuring secure payment gateways is crucial.
Taking a proactive approach, such as investing in secure hosting to protect your customers’ sensitive data, helps build trust in your online business.
Tecnotrade Tips:
Add HTTPS (HyperText Transfer Protocol Secure) and SSL (Secure Sockets Layer) to encrypt data transmission through your e-commerce website’s hosting.
Besides choosing the best CMS for your e-commerce, opt for reliable payment processors like PayPal, Stripe, 2Checkout, and Square.
Implement two-factor authentication for your payment gateway. This adds an extra layer of security for your customers.
Keep your website software and plugins updated, including payment gateways, with the latest security patches and updates.
Consider tokenization; it replaces sensitive data like credit card numbers with a unique identifier (token).

Question #7:
Is your website connected to Google Analytics to track and analyze site performance and customer behavior?
Ensuring a reliable hosting security for your website is just as important as tracking and analyzing the website’s performance and customer interactions.
A trusted marketing and web design agency would recommend using Google Analytics 4 to help you make informed decisions.
Tecnotrade Tips:
If you don’t already have an account, sign up at analytics.google.com.
Install the Google Analytics 4 tracking code by copying and pasting it into the header section of your website’s HTML code just before the closing </head> tag.
Enable e-commerce tracking in Google Analytics 4 settings to monitor valuable data such as transaction details, product performance, and revenue.
Tracked e-commerce provides deeper insights into customer behavior during the purchase journey, including product impact, shopping behavior, and purchase funnel tracking.
To ensure accurate data, exclude internal traffic from tracking in Google Analytics 4. Filter your IP address to prevent visitor count inflation and metric distortion.

Question #8:
Have you thoroughly tested your website to identify and fix any issues or bugs?
Testing is fundamental when creating a website.
Therefore, besides pre-launch testing, remember that testing should be a continuous process, especially when making updates or changes to the website.
Tecnotrade Tips:
Develop a detailed testing plan outlining the areas and features to test, including scenarios such as different devices, browsers, and user interactions.
Test and verify that all website functionalities (product pages, shopping cart, checkout process, user accounts, search functions, and any interactive elements) work as expected.
Evaluate how your website handles error scenarios, such as invalid inputs, broken links, or server errors. Ensure users receive clear error messages and are redirected appropriately.
Verify that all automated email notifications, such as order confirmations, shipping updates, and password resets, are sent correctly and reach recipients.
Provide users with a way to report bugs and provide feedback through your website; make sure to prioritize user-reported issues.
